The Role

We are seeking a Senior Case Management Associate to help ensure that members with complex or high-risk health needs receive safe, timely, and well-coordinated care. You will manage complex cases, identify risks to patient care, and work with doctors, hospitals, and internal teams to resolve problems and prevent delays in care. You will also support the review of deaths, ICU and other high-risk admissions, and possible cases of fraud, waste, and abuse. As a senior member of the team, you will guide junior case management staff and help improve how the team manages cases. You will use patient and service data to identify problems and improve the quality, safety, and efficiency of care

What You’ll Do

  • Manage complex, high-risk, and escalated cases to ensure patients receive safe, timely, and appropriate care.
  • Coordinate care with healthcare providers, emergency services, and internal clinical teams to resolve barriers and improve patient outcomes.
  • Monitor ICU and other high-risk admissions, ensuring timely interventions and appropriate care management.
  • Identify patient safety and clinical risks, take necessary action, and escalate concerns when required.
  • Maintain accurate documentation of case reviews, decisions, actions, and outcomes.
  • Review clinical quality complaints, adverse events, morbidity, and mortality cases, and ensure appropriate follow-up actions.
  • Conduct onsite clinical reviews at healthcare facilities, including the assessment of medical records and quality of care provided.
  • Monitor patient safety, quality, and care coordination issues across the provider network and recommend improvements.
  • Review claims, medical records, billing information, and other data to identify potential fraud, waste, and abuse (FWA).
  • Investigate suspected FWA cases in collaboration with providers, clinical teams, and other internal stakeholders.
  • Support the implementation of appropriate actions on confirmed FWA cases, including provider engagement and escalation where necessary.
  • Ensure all case reviews, investigations, and activities comply with company policies and applicable regulations.
  • Provide guidance, coaching, and technical support to junior members of the Case Management team.
  • Support team development by guiding colleagues through complex cases and strengthening their clinical judgement and case management skills.
  • Collaborate with Provider Management and other internal teams to resolve patient care issues and improve provider performance.
  • Maintain professional and independent clinical judgement when engaging with healthcare providers and other stakeholders.

Requirements

What You’ll Bring

  • Bachelor of Medicine, Bachelor of Surgery (MBBS or equivalent) or Bachelor of Nursing Science (BNSc or equivalent).
  • Current and valid professional license to practice in Nigeria.
  • Minimum of 5 years of post-qualification clinical experience, with experience managing complex or high-risk patient cases.
  • Experience in case management, care coordination, clinical case review, or a similar healthcare role.
  • Experience reviewing medical records and applying clinical guidelines to assess the quality and appropriateness of patient care.
  • Willingness and ability to conduct field visits to hospitals and other healthcare facilities when required.
  • Must meet all company requirements for professional license verification, background checks, and disclosure of any restrictions or pending matters that may affect clinical practice.

Nice to Have

  • Experience in health insurance, managed care, or healthcare operations.
  • Experience conducting clinical audits, mortality reviews, quality investigations, or patient safety reviews.
  • Experience investigating fraud, waste, and abuse (FWA) or reviewing healthcare claims and utilization data.
  • Experience coaching, mentoring, or providing technical guidance to junior clinical staff.
  • Experience using healthcare data to identify trends and support quality improvement.
  • Relevant certification or training in emergency care/triage, patient safety, quality improvement, clinical audit, or healthcare FWA.
